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
OpenHarmony
Docs
提交
d1ee5b5b
D
Docs
项目概览
OpenHarmony
/
Docs
大约 2 年 前同步成功
通知
161
Star
293
Fork
28
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
0
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
D
Docs
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
提交
Issue看板
未验证
提交
d1ee5b5b
编写于
6月 12, 2023
作者:
O
openharmony_ci
提交者:
Gitee
6月 12, 2023
浏览文件
操作
浏览文件
下载
差异文件
!19535 【资料问题】挑单补充处理废弃接口引入问题
Merge pull request !19535 from yuyaozhi/OpenHarmony-4.0-Beta1
上级
1e0be9c7
01a10bf2
变更
8
隐藏空白更改
内联
并排
Showing
8 changed file
with
20 addition
and
20 deletion
+20
-20
zh-cn/application-dev/application-models/access-dataability.md
.../application-dev/application-models/access-dataability.md
+2
-2
zh-cn/application-dev/application-models/application-context-fa.md
...lication-dev/application-models/application-context-fa.md
+2
-2
zh-cn/application-dev/application-models/connect-serviceability.md
...lication-dev/application-models/connect-serviceability.md
+5
-5
zh-cn/application-dev/application-models/create-dataability.md
.../application-dev/application-models/create-dataability.md
+3
-3
zh-cn/application-dev/application-models/js-ui-widget-development.md
...cation-dev/application-models/js-ui-widget-development.md
+3
-3
zh-cn/application-dev/application-models/widget-development-fa.md
...plication-dev/application-models/widget-development-fa.md
+3
-3
zh-cn/application-dev/reference/apis/js-apis-inner-ability-dataAbilityHelper.md
...reference/apis/js-apis-inner-ability-dataAbilityHelper.md
+1
-1
zh-cn/application-dev/reference/apis/js-apis-inner-application-serviceExtensionContext.md
...apis/js-apis-inner-application-serviceExtensionContext.md
+1
-1
未找到文件。
zh-cn/application-dev/application-models/access-dataability.md
浏览文件 @
d1ee5b5b
...
...
@@ -11,7 +11,7 @@
-
@ohos.data.dataAbility
-
@ohos.data.r
db
-
@ohos.data.r
elationalStore
访问DataAbility的示例代码如下:
...
...
@@ -23,7 +23,7 @@
// 作为参数传递的URI,与config中定义的URI的区别是多了一个"/",有三个"/"
import
featureAbility
from
'
@ohos.ability.featureAbility
'
import
ohos_data_ability
from
'
@ohos.data.dataAbility
'
import
ohos_data_rdb
from
'
@ohos.data.rdb
'
import
relationalStore
from
'
@ohos.data.relationalStore
'
let
urivar
=
"
dataability:///com.ix.DataAbility
"
let
DAHelper
=
featureAbility
.
acquireDataAbilityHelper
(
urivar
);
...
...
zh-cn/application-dev/application-models/application-context-fa.md
浏览文件 @
d1ee5b5b
...
...
@@ -48,13 +48,13 @@ let context = featureAbility.getContext()
```
ts
import
featureAbility
from
'
@ohos.ability.featureAbility
'
import
bundle
from
'
@ohos.bundle
'
;
import
bundle
Manager
from
'
@ohos.bundle.bundleManager
'
;
export
default
{
onCreate
()
{
// 获取context并调用相关方法
let
context
=
featureAbility
.
getContext
();
context
.
setDisplayOrientation
(
bundle
.
DisplayOrientation
.
LANDSCAPE
).
then
(()
=>
{
context
.
setDisplayOrientation
(
bundle
Manager
.
DisplayOrientation
.
LANDSCAPE
).
then
(()
=>
{
console
.
info
(
"
Set display orientation.
"
)
})
console
.
info
(
'
Application onCreate
'
)
...
...
zh-cn/application-dev/application-models/connect-serviceability.md
浏览文件 @
d1ee5b5b
...
...
@@ -17,14 +17,14 @@ PageAbility创建连接本地ServiceAbility回调实例的代码以及连接本
```
ts
import
rpc
from
"
@ohos.rpc
"
import
prompt
from
'
@system.prompt
'
import
prompt
Action
from
'
@ohos.promptAction
'
import
featureAbility
from
'
@ohos.ability.featureAbility
'
let
option
=
{
onConnect
:
function
onConnectCallback
(
element
,
proxy
)
{
console
.
info
(
`onConnectLocalService onConnectDone`
)
if
(
proxy
===
null
)
{
prompt
.
showToast
({
prompt
Action
.
showToast
({
message
:
"
Connect service failed
"
})
return
...
...
@@ -34,19 +34,19 @@ let option = {
let
option
=
new
rpc
.
MessageOption
()
data
.
writeInterfaceToken
(
"
connect.test.token
"
)
proxy
.
sendRequest
(
0
,
data
,
reply
,
option
)
prompt
.
showToast
({
prompt
Action
.
showToast
({
message
:
"
Connect service success
"
})
},
onDisconnect
:
function
onDisconnectCallback
(
element
)
{
console
.
info
(
`onConnectLocalService onDisconnectDone element:
${
element
}
`
)
prompt
.
showToast
({
prompt
Action
.
showToast
({
message
:
"
Disconnect service success
"
})
},
onFailed
:
function
onFailedCallback
(
code
)
{
console
.
info
(
`onConnectLocalService onFailed errCode:
${
code
}
`
)
prompt
.
showToast
({
prompt
Action
.
showToast
({
message
:
"
Connect local service onFailed
"
})
}
...
...
zh-cn/application-dev/application-models/create-dataability.md
浏览文件 @
d1ee5b5b
...
...
@@ -9,18 +9,18 @@
```
ts
import
featureAbility
from
'
@ohos.ability.featureAbility
'
import
dataAbility
from
'
@ohos.data.dataAbility
'
import
dataRdb
from
'
@ohos.data.rdb
'
import
relationalStore
from
'
@ohos.data.relationalStore
'
const
TABLE_NAME
=
'
book
'
const
STORE_CONFIG
=
{
name
:
'
book.db
'
}
const
SQL_CREATE_TABLE
=
'
CREATE TABLE IF NOT EXISTS book(id INTEGER PRIMARY KEY AUTOINCREMENT, name TEXT NOT NULL, introduction TEXT NOT NULL)
'
let
rdbStore
:
dataRdb
.
RdbStore
=
undefined
let
rdbStore
:
relationalStore
.
RdbStore
=
undefined
export
default
{
onInitialized
(
abilityInfo
)
{
console
.
info
(
'
DataAbility onInitialized, abilityInfo:
'
+
abilityInfo
.
bundleName
)
let
context
=
featureAbility
.
getContext
()
dataRdb
.
getRdbStore
(
context
,
STORE_CONFIG
,
1
,
(
err
,
store
)
=>
{
relationalStore
.
getRdbStore
(
context
,
STORE_CONFIG
,
(
err
,
store
)
=>
{
console
.
info
(
'
DataAbility getRdbStore callback
'
)
store
.
executeSql
(
SQL_CREATE_TABLE
,
[])
rdbStore
=
store
...
...
zh-cn/application-dev/application-models/js-ui-widget-development.md
浏览文件 @
d1ee5b5b
...
...
@@ -102,7 +102,7 @@ Stage卡片开发,即基于[Stage模型](stage-model-development-overview.md)
import
formBindingData
from
'
@ohos.app.form.formBindingData
'
;
import
formInfo
from
'
@ohos.app.form.formInfo
'
;
import
formProvider
from
'
@ohos.app.form.formProvider
'
;
import
data
Storage
from
'
@ohos.data.storage
'
;
import
data
Preferences
from
'
@ohos.data.preferences
'
;
```
2.
在EntryFormAbility.ts中,实现FormExtension生命周期接口。
...
...
@@ -255,7 +255,7 @@ async function storeFormInfo(formId: string, formName: string, tempFlag: boolean
"
updateCount
"
:
0
};
try
{
const
storage
=
await
data
Storage
.
getStorage
(
DATA_STORAGE_PATH
);
const
storage
=
await
data
Preferences
.
getPreferences
(
this
.
context
,
DATA_STORAGE_PATH
);
// put form info
await
storage
.
put
(
formId
,
JSON
.
stringify
(
formInfo
));
console
.
info
(
`[EntryFormAbility] storeFormInfo, put form info successfully, formId:
${
formId
}
`
);
...
...
@@ -294,7 +294,7 @@ export default class EntryFormAbility extends FormExtension {
const
DATA_STORAGE_PATH
=
"
/data/storage/el2/base/haps/form_store
"
;
async
function
deleteFormInfo
(
formId
:
string
)
{
try
{
const
storage
=
await
data
Storage
.
getStorage
(
DATA_STORAGE_PATH
);
const
storage
=
await
data
Preferences
.
getPreferences
(
this
.
context
,
DATA_STORAGE_PATH
);
// del form info
await
storage
.
delete
(
formId
);
console
.
info
(
`[EntryFormAbility] deleteFormInfo, del form info successfully, formId:
${
formId
}
`
);
...
...
zh-cn/application-dev/application-models/widget-development-fa.md
浏览文件 @
d1ee5b5b
...
...
@@ -114,7 +114,7 @@ FA卡片开发,即基于[FA模型](fa-model-development-overview.md)的卡片
import
formBindingData
from
'
@ohos.app.form.formBindingData
'
;
import
formInfo
from
'
@ohos.app.form.formInfo
'
;
import
formProvider
from
'
@ohos.app.form.formProvider
'
;
import
data
Storage
from
'
@ohos.data.storage
'
;
import
data
Preferences
from
'
@ohos.data.preferences
'
;
```
2.
在form.ts中,实现卡片生命周期接口
...
...
@@ -263,7 +263,7 @@ async function storeFormInfo(formId: string, formName: string, tempFlag: boolean
"
updateCount
"
:
0
};
try
{
const
storage
=
await
data
Storage
.
getStorage
(
DATA_STORAGE_PATH
);
const
storage
=
await
data
Preferences
.
getPreferences
(
this
.
context
,
DATA_STORAGE_PATH
);
// put form info
await
storage
.
put
(
formId
,
JSON
.
stringify
(
formInfo
));
console
.
info
(
`storeFormInfo, put form info successfully, formId:
${
formId
}
`
);
...
...
@@ -301,7 +301,7 @@ async function storeFormInfo(formId: string, formName: string, tempFlag: boolean
const
DATA_STORAGE_PATH
=
"
/data/storage/el2/base/haps/form_store
"
;
async
function
deleteFormInfo
(
formId
:
string
)
{
try
{
const
storage
=
await
data
Storage
.
getStorage
(
DATA_STORAGE_PATH
);
const
storage
=
await
data
Preferences
.
getPreferences
(
this
.
context
,
DATA_STORAGE_PATH
);
// del form info
await
storage
.
delete
(
formId
);
console
.
info
(
`deleteFormInfo, del form info successfully, formId:
${
formId
}
`
);
...
...
zh-cn/application-dev/reference/apis/js-apis-inner-ability-dataAbilityHelper.md
浏览文件 @
d1ee5b5b
...
...
@@ -18,7 +18,7 @@ import ability from '@ohos.ability.ability';
使用前根据具体情况引入如下模块
```
ts
import
ohos_data_ability
from
'
@ohos.data.dataAbility
'
;
import
ohos_data_rdb
from
'
@ohos.data.rdb
'
;
import
relationalStore
from
'
@ohos.data.relationalStore
'
```
## DataAbilityHelper.openFile
...
...
zh-cn/application-dev/reference/apis/js-apis-inner-application-serviceExtensionContext.md
浏览文件 @
d1ee5b5b
...
...
@@ -985,7 +985,7 @@ terminateSelf(callback: AsyncCallback<void>): void;
terminateSelf(): Promise
<
void
>
;
停止自身。通过Promise返回结果。
停止
ability
自身。通过Promise返回结果。
**系统能力**
:SystemCapability.Ability.AbilityRuntime.Core
...
...
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录